Randstad lists 12 key markets for cybersecurity talent

September 14, 2016

Demand is strong for cybersecurity talent in 12 key markets nationwide, according to Randstad Technologies “Cybersecurity Workforce Report,” released today. The report names key markets nationwide with strong demand for top-tier, enterprise-level cybersecurity talent.

Washington, DC, reported the most open job listings at 3,524 jobs, as well as the most direct employers currently competing for those employees at 743 employers. New York also reported a tight market, with 1,500 jobs posted by 453 employers.

The demand in these markets was determined based on a combination of employer volume for talent and number of open job listings. The markets and the open jobs posted by direct employers currently competing are:

  • Atlanta: 652 open jobs posted by 248 direct employers
  • Austin: 270 jobs posted by 98 employers
  • Boston: 604 jobs posted by 260 employers
  • Chicago: 627 jobs posted by 242 employers
  • Dallas: 776 jobs posted by 243 employers
  • Los Angeles: 641 jobs posted by 238 employers
  • Minneapolis: 444 jobs posted by 136 employers
  • New York: 1,500 jobs posted by 453 employers
  • Phoenix: 374 jobs posted by 127 employers
  • San Francisco: 801 jobs posted by 277 employers
  • Seattle: 556 jobs posted by 148 employers
  • Washington, DC: 3,524 jobs posted by 743 employers

Cybersecurity talent is highly sought after not only in these markets but also nationwide, according to the report. Between June 2014 and June 2016, demand surged 35% year over year.

“This data is not surprising, given that nearly every industry in today’s enterprise ecosystem could fall victim to a security breach of their IT systems,” said Dino Grigorakakis, VP of recruiting at Randstad Technologies. “We are working with CIOs who now rank security and cybersecurity expertise as one of the most essential needs for their IT departments, and we are helping them attract willing and highly qualified candidates from their own back yard.”

Randstad Technologies’ report of 12 markets with high demand for cybersecurity talent is derived from an analysis of proprietary data from Randstad Technologies and Wanted Analytics.
